Understanding the Role of a Notary in Kentucky

In Kentucky, a notary public serves as an official witness to the signing of documents, ensuring that the signatures are authentic and that the individuals signing are doing so willingly. Notaries play a crucial role in preventing fraud and ensuring the integrity of legal documents. They can administer oaths, take affidavits, and certify copies of documents. Understanding these responsibilities is essential for anyone considering becoming a notary in Kentucky.

Eligibility Requirements to Become a Notary in Kentucky

To become a notary in Kentucky, applicants must meet specific eligibility criteria. These include:

  • Being at least eighteen years old.
  • Being a resident of Kentucky or employed within the state.
  • Having no felony convictions or disqualifying misdemeanors.

Meeting these requirements is the first step in the notary application process, ensuring that candidates are responsible and trustworthy individuals.

The Application Process for Notary Public in Kentucky

The application process to become a notary public in Kentucky involves several steps:

  1. Complete an application form, which can be obtained from the Kentucky Secretary of State's website.
  2. Obtain a surety bond of $1,000, which protects the public from any errors made while performing notarial acts.
  3. Submit the completed application, bond, and any required fees to the Secretary of State for approval.

Once approved, applicants will receive their notary commission, allowing them to begin their duties as a notary public.

Maintaining Notary Status in Kentucky

After becoming a notary, it is important to maintain your status. This includes:

  • Renewing your notary commission every four years.
  • Keeping accurate records of all notarial acts performed.
  • Adhering to the laws and regulations governing notaries in Kentucky.

By following these guidelines, notaries can ensure they remain compliant and continue to serve their communities effectively.

Common Documents Notarized in Kentucky

Notaries in Kentucky frequently handle a variety of documents, including:

  • Wills and trusts
  • Power of attorney forms
  • Real estate documents
  • Affidavits and declarations

Understanding the types of documents commonly notarized can help new notaries prepare for their responsibilities and better serve their clients.
